The Airwalk Kölnbrein Dam is a spectacular viewpoint perched atop Austria's tallest dam, the Kölnbrein Dam, in the heart of Carinthia. Situated at an elevation of 1778 meters within the majestic Hohe Tauern range, this cantilevered viewing terrace offers an unparalleled perspective of the surrounding high-alpine landscape and the deep Malta Valley. It stands as a testament to both natural beauty and impressive engineering, making it a unique destination for those exploring the Spittal an der Drau District.

Access to the Airwalk Kölnbrein Dam itself is generally free. However, you will need to pay a toll to drive on the scenic Malta High Alpine Road, which is the primary route to reach the dam. This road is typically open seasonally.
Direct public transport to the Airwalk Kölnbrein Dam is not widely available. The most common way to reach the dam is by car via the Malta High Alpine Road. Some local tour operators might offer shuttle services during peak season, but it's best to check with local tourism offices for current options.

Situated at an elevation of 1778 meters in the Hohe Tauern range, the Airwalk Kölnbrein Dam experiences alpine weather conditions. This means it can be significantly cooler and windier than in the valleys, even during summer. Weather can change rapidly, so visitors should be prepared for varying conditions, including sun, wind, and potential rain, regardless of the season. Always check the local forecast before heading up.
Access to the Airwalk Kölnbrein Dam is primarily via the Malta High Alpine Road, which is typically closed during the winter months due to heavy snow and ice. Therefore, the Airwalk is generally not accessible in winter. The best time to visit is during the warmer months when the road is open, usually from late spring to early autumn.
Yes, there is a Berghotel Malta located at the dam site, which features a panoramic restaurant. This provides options for meals and refreshments. For more extensive accommodation choices or additional dining, visitors would typically look in the nearby Malta Valley or the wider Spittal an der Drau District.
As a popular attraction, the Airwalk Kölnbrein Dam can experience significant crowds, particularly on weekends, public holidays, and during the peak summer season. The Malta High Alpine Road can also get busy. To avoid the largest crowds, consider visiting on weekdays or arriving early in the morning, especially if you want to secure parking easily.
While the Airwalk itself is the main attraction, the entire Malta High Alpine Road offers numerous picturesque stops and viewpoints along its winding path, showcasing waterfalls and tunnels. Exploring the various hiking trails around the Kölnbrein Dam can also lead to less-frequented spots with stunning views of the high-alpine landscape and the reservoir, away from the main dam area.
